MANAGER Ronald Koeman has urged his players to embrace the challenge of playing on big stages like Old Trafford and show they are ready to make ‘the next step’.
The Everton boss reiterated his pride at the way his youthful team performed in the white-hot atmosphere of a Merseyside derby at the weekend, despite defeat.
With senior internationals Seamus Coleman, Morgan Schneiderlin, Ramiro Funes Mori and James McCarthy all ruled out of the trip to Anfield through injury, Koeman turned to youth against Liverpool, with Matthew Pennington, Mason Holgate and Dominic Calvert-Lewin joining Tom Davies in the starting line-up, whilst Jonjoe Kenny and Ademola Lookman were named on the bench.
